More and more, organizations are becoming aware of the need to better manage their electronic information and that a lack of a disciplined approach can affect the way they do business, their ability to respond to a disaster or comply with legislation. This course provides managers and information management (IM) practitioners an overview of how to asses the state of an organization’s IM program; for example, how well they are managing their information assets, where they are at risk, whether their staff have the required level of competency in order to fulfill their IM duties, and if IM technology tools are being used effectively.
At the end of the course, students will be able to: understand three common different types IM analyses projects namely: IM assessment, EIM readiness assessment, and post-implementation EIM evaluation; understand when you would use each, and a high-level approach to conduct each IM analysis
